Output e6ee164e71ddf5a17d05cf31008b27bdc6d777359d5a8658a58f768aec7aa853:21

value
44979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59424670c370d35b041ca15ad14cad6eac2fb8c0 OP_EQUAL
address
39pyTVghhTHjYRL6JWJoqFPr8gWQNyQaRS
transaction
e6ee164e71ddf5a17d05cf31008b27bdc6d777359d5a8658a58f768aec7aa853
spent
true